How to Book Tickets for Egypt‘s Top Attractions325
Egypt, the land of ancient wonders and captivating history, offers a treasure trove of attractions that beckon travelers from around the world. From the iconic pyramids of Giza to the enigmatic temples of Luxor, there's something to fascinate every visitor.
To fully immerse yourself in Egypt's rich heritage, planning your itinerary and securing tickets in advance is essential. Here's a comprehensive guide to help you navigate the booking process for Egypt's top attractions:
1. Pyramids of Giza
No trip to Egypt is complete without a visit to the legendary Pyramids of Giza. These colossal structures, built as tombs for the pharaohs, are a testament to ancient architectural ingenuity. To visit the Pyramids of Giza, you can purchase a combined ticket that includes entry to the Great Pyramid, the Second Pyramid, and the Third Pyramid. Tickets are available online through the official website of the Egyptian Ministry of Tourism and Antiquities or at the ticket office located at the Giza Plateau.
2. Great Sphinx of Giza
Standing guard over the Pyramids of Giza is the enigmatic Great Sphinx, a colossal limestone statue carved from a single piece of rock. The Sphinx embodies the pharaoh Khafre and symbolizes the power and authority of the ancient Egyptian rulers. To visit the Great Sphinx, you will need to purchase a separate ticket, which is available at the ticket office located near the statue.
3. Egyptian Museum
For a deep dive into Egypt's ancient civilization, head to the Egyptian Museum in Cairo. This renowned museum houses an extensive collection of artifacts, including the treasures of King Tutankhamun's tomb. To visit the Egyptian Museum, you can purchase a standard ticket or opt for a guided tour, which provides valuable insights into the exhibits. Tickets are available online through the museum's website or at the ticket counter.
4. Luxor Temple
In the ancient city of Luxor, the Luxor Temple stands as a testament to the grandeur of ancient Egypt. Dedicated to the god Amun-Re, Luxor Temple played a significant role in religious ceremonies and festivals. To visit Luxor Temple, you can purchase a ticket at the entrance or through tour operators. Nightly sound and light shows are also available, offering a captivating experience under the stars.
5. Valley of the Kings
Nestled in the hills across the Nile from Luxor, the Valley of the Kings is the burial ground of the pharaohs of the New Kingdom. Here, you will find elaborate tombs adorned with breathtaking hieroglyphs and paintings. To visit the Valley of the Kings, you must purchase a ticket, which allows you to enter three tombs of your choice. Tickets can be purchased at the entrance to the valley or through tour operators.
6. Temple of Hatshepsut
Situated on the west bank of the Nile River, the Temple of Hatshepsut is a remarkable architectural masterpiece dedicated to the female pharaoh Hatshepsut. The temple, carved into the sheer cliffs, features stunning terraces and colonnades. To visit the Temple of Hatshepsut, you can purchase a ticket at the entrance or through tour operators.
7. Karnak Temple Complex
The Karnak Temple Complex is an awe-inspiring collection of temples, chapels, and other sacred structures located in Luxor. This sprawling complex is home to the Great Temple of Amun-Re, the Karnak Open Air Museum, and the Luxor Museum. To visit the Karnak Temple Complex, you can purchase a combined ticket, which grants you access to all the major attractions within the complex.
Tips for Booking Tickets* Book your tickets in advance, especially if you're traveling during peak season, to avoid long lines and ensure availability.
* Consider purchasing a combined ticket that includes multiple attractions to save time and money.
* Look for discounts and special offers, such as student or group discounts, to maximize your budget.
* Be aware of the operating hours of the attractions and plan your visits accordingly.
* Dress appropriately for the desert climate and wear comfortable shoes as you will be doing a lot of walking.
* Remember to bring your camera to capture the unforgettable moments of your adventure in Egypt.
